# Digest Scheduling Capacity Note

The Mornwick digest batcher fans out once per window per region. Peak load lands at window open; workers scale on queue depth, not CPU. Keep batch sizes conservative — oversized batches stall the Pellor SMTP relay. New hires: never change windows without updating the relay reservation. Current scheduling constants are as follows.

tuning table, yajog-yahof:
BUDGETS = {
    "lamvan": 303,
    "wenox": 460,
    "fenvan": 525,
}

Quarterly Planning Note — Divestiture of the Coastal Tooling Unit

For the finance team: the sale of the Coastal Tooling unit to Pellmark Industries remains on track for close in Q3. Please finalize the carve-out balance sheet, reconcile intercompany positions, and prepare the working-capital adjustment schedule by month-end. Audit support requests should be prioritized. For planning purposes, note the following sensitive item:

internal memo for hawef-kahif: The finance team signed off on a budget of $25.9 million for Project Sorox. The renewal with Pelokek Logistics closes at $51.7 million a year, 52 percent below the last contract.

This change to the Wrenfold ingest service adds head-based log sampling, which is why support will see fewer duplicate lines in the Copperspine viewer starting next release. Important for triage: sampled-out lines are counted, not lost silently, and the drop counter appears in each request summary, so you can tell whether a quiet trace means a quiet request or an aggressive sample rate. The rates shipping with this build are listed below.

tuning table, hafog-bahaf:
QUOTAS = {
    "praion": 144,
    "briax": 906,
    "silwyn": 451,
}

Subject: Seat-map renderer — new owner

Plugin authors: ownership of the Gildhall seat-map renderer has changed effective this sprint. API surface is unchanged; the v4 deprecation timeline still stands. File rendering bugs against the renderer component, not the booking core. All plugin compatibility questions and review requests now go to:

named custodian: Belius Casath Ulaix Sorius